| description |
A self-consistent statistical method is used to calculate the Gibbs free energy of vacancy formation in
heavy rare gas crystals at high temperature. It is shown that the vacancy formation free energy rapidly falls
in the vicinity of the melting point of the crystal. Such behavior is attributed to approaching the anharmonic
instability point of vibrational subsystem of the solid.
